With writer/director James Gunn having long confirmed a third Guardians of the Galaxy movie, the charming Gunn has revealed just when we can expect to see the final piece of his Guardians trilogy.

Taking to his Twitter account, a 2020 release has been seemingly confirmed:

Marvel Studios has already got three untitled pictures booked in for 2020, with the dates of said films set as May 1st, August 7th, and November 6th. Logic dictates that one of these dates has now been nabbed by Star Lord and Co. for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 3.

James Gunn has already gone on record to say that Guardians 3 will be the final movie for this current incarnation of the Guardians team, and it’s believed to be a further launching point for Marvel’s Cosmic Universe. Of course, it’s not been ruled out that there will indeed be more Guardians efforts, just that if they happened then they’d involve a different line-up to Star-Lord, Gamora, Drax, Rocket Racoon, and Groot.

Up next for the Guardians, of course, is this May’s Avengers: Infinity War. That movie will see the ragtag bunch – including Nebula and Mantis – team-up with Earth’s Mightiest Heroes as Thanos finally steps out of the shadows. As well as that, the Guardians are also expected to be a part of May 2019’s Infinity War follow-up.
